Have you not dived in a while or have you forgotten how to react in certain situations?
The ReActivate course is designed to refresh your knowledge and diving skills. It aims to meet you where you are in your current knowledge base and to delve deeper into topics that may have become a bit rusty.

Sequence
As preparation, we will send you the PADI ReActivate eLearning so that you can comfortably refresh your theory from home.
In our shop, we'll discuss your questions about the theory, which exercises you'd like to practice, and how to properly set up your equipment. Then we'll head to the dive site, where we'll first practice the discussed diving exercises in shallow water. These include at least removing and replacing your mask, establishing neutral buoyancy control, emergency weight jettison at the surface, and ascending using an alternate air supply.
After completing the exercises, we will use the remaining air to explore the dive site and apply what we have learned.
Finally, you will receive an updated eCard with a ReActivate note, which you can present on your next diving trip.

What will I learn in the theory sessions, and is there an exam?
The eLearning course refreshes the theory for the Open Water Diver certification, explains the most important diving rules, and reinforces them through quizzes. There is no written exam. To test your knowledge, we will give you review questions to answer on-site.

Are we diving from the boat or from the shore?
We are very fortunate here in Cyprus to have fantastic dive sites right off the shore. One of the most famous dive sites is Green Bay in Protaras, which is only a few minutes away. Here we have a natural pool with no waves or currents and shallow water. It's the perfect place for us to practice our skills and descend slowly and comfortably from the shore.
